Crawl Out From Under the Covers

By: Maria Flynn

Do you often challenge yourself? New ways of doing business, or approaching a situation, are sometimes uncomfortable for us. We're creatures of habit, and most of us are somewhat fearful of change. But if you play it "safe" by doing what you've always done, or the way you've always done it (whatever "it" might be), you'll never get to the next level Successful people look at uncertain situations as opportunities for growth, not something to be feared. Don't worry about the unknown,... like what might happen. Focus on the positive. View every obstacle as an opportunity, and learn something new from it. You can never "fail", as long as you learn something from your efforts. And most people learn more from their perceived "failures" than from their successes Personally, I've found that 99.9 percent of the time, what I worry about never happens. Don't waste time worrying.

How about networking?

This is a really good example for many of us. At first, it might be really uncomfortable for you, but like anything, the more you do it, the better and easier it will be. And look at it this way. Networking is an excellent replacement for cold calling, and networking can lead to referrals.

 

Many people never go after their dreams for a better life because they are afraid of change. The fact is that most of the time you cannot move ahead without leaving something behind. If you are not getting what you want out of life, you have to change your approach to it. To get what you want, you have to become the person who deserves it. And that means changing attitudes, maybe even changing important parts of your life.
